Mary places headphones on her pregnant belly so that her baby can hear classical music. She notices that her baby moves less as

a result of the soft, soothing music. What type of environment is being impacted by music?
Social Studies
1 answer:
Y_Kistochka [10]3 years ago
7 0

Answer: Intrauterine

Explanation:

Intrauterine is the space of the body which is inside the uterus of the pregnant woman.It can contain fetal pole or yolk sac in the gestational sac of the uterus.

According to the question,music is influencing intrauterine environment as Mary is placing headphones on her belly as she is pregnant.She is performing this act to make the baby who is present in gestational sac can listen to the soothing sound for less movement .
